Guaranty Bonds Are Insurance Coverage
Guaranty bonds aren't insurance plan. This is an usual false impression that many individuals have. It is very important to comprehend the distinction between the two.
Insurance coverage are designed to safeguard the insured party from prospective future losses. They give insurance coverage for a vast array of risks, consisting of residential or commercial property damages, responsibility, and personal injury.
On the other hand, surety bonds are a kind of guarantee that guarantees a details responsibility will certainly be fulfilled. They're commonly utilized in building tasks to ensure that contractors finish their work as set. The guaranty bond provides financial security to the project owner in case the professional stops working to satisfy their obligations.
Guaranty Bonds Are Only for Building and construction Tasks
Now allow's change our emphasis to the misunderstanding that guaranty bonds are solely made use of in building jobs. While it's true that surety bonds are generally connected with the building and construction market, they aren't limited to it.
Guaranty bonds are in fact used in various sectors and industries to ensure that contractual commitments are fulfilled. As an example, they're utilized in the transport sector for products brokers and providers, in the production market for suppliers and suppliers, and in the service industry for professionals such as plumbers and electricians.
